A Japan Ground Self Defense Forces jumpmaster looks out a side door of a C-130J Super Hercules assigned to the 36th Airlift Squadron from Yokota Air Base, Japan, during a bilateral jump training mission at Ojoji drop zone, Japan, July 9, 2020. Over the course of two days, Japan Ground Self Defense Force and Yokota service members completed the training mission, enhancing U.S. and Japanese interoperability.
